a group purchased 10 hotdogs and 5 drinks at a cost of 320. a second group bought 7 hotdogs and 4 drinks at 228.50. how much is the cost of one hotdog? a drink?

OpenStudy (nincompoop):

set things up as a systems of equation then solve for the hotdog
